Current Challenges
Over the last decade, European health systems have faced growing common challenges:
- increasing cost of healthcare;
- population ageing associated with a rise of chronic diseases and multi-morbidity leading to growing demand for healthcare;
- shortages and uneven distribution of health professionals;
- health inequalities and inequities in access to healthcare.
The economic crisis has also limited the financial resources available and thus aggravated Member States’ difficulties in ensuring their health systems’ ability to provide quality and equitable care.
There is thus an urgent need to bring innovation and research evidence to identify more effective and sustainable ways to organise, manage, finance, and deliver high-quality care to European citizens.
